Dr. Edgar Correa attended West Virginia University as well as the Inter-American University of Puerto Rico and majored in Chemistry. Upon early acceptance, he attended and received his Doctor of Podiatric Medicine degree from the Ohio College of Podiatric Medicine and graduated in the top 10% of his class. His postdoctoral training includes surgical residencies at Community General Hospital in Thomasville, North Carolina and Florida Hospital Health System located in Orlando, Florida. During this time Dr. Correa trained in reconstructive foot and ankle surgery/trauma, sports-related injuries, and general foot and ankle care.
After residency, Dr. Correa practiced in Orlando for approximately 3 years before relocating to North Carolina in 2002. He is board certified by the American Board of Podiatric Surgery, a Fellow of the American College of Foot and Ankle Surgeons, and a member of the North Carolina Foot and Ankle Society. He is also fluent in both Spanish and English.
